Test Valley are leading the way in helping decarbonise small businesses in their Borough.  

The IncuHive Group Ltd and Accelar Ltd are proud to be able to support these companies in the first of a series of workshops.

Come and learn about the climate crisis, what all the jargon means, how transitioning to Net Zero can benefit your business and there’s even an opportunity to get some free money.

    George, fuelled by an entrepreneurial drive and a longing for autonomy, spent nine years in the London property industry, aiming to amass the resources to venture out on his own. At 30, he bid farewell to London and co-founded Kiss Gyms, a highly acclaimed and budget-friendly gym chain. George successfully exited Kiss in 2020, leaving behind a thriving business. 

    For the past six years, George has been an integral part of IncuHive, ultimately acquiring the business in August 2023. IncuHive operates business centres and coworking spaces spanning Wiltshire, Hampshire, and Surrey, providing extensive business support and training services throughout the southern region. Passionate about the journey towards Net Zero, George is committed to aiding small businesses in their decarbonization efforts.
